Purpose and Function of the ICM Plus Module
The presented ICM Plus module is used in BMW F20, F22, F30, F32, and F36 platforms, where it serves as the central unit for processing data from sensors responsible for driving stability and safety. It integrates signals from various sub-assemblies, enabling the correct operation of driver assistance systems and coordination of functions related to driving path control.
By using an original controller, the consistency of the vehicle's software and electrical architecture is maintained, which reduces the risk of communication errors on the bus and facilitates diagnostics. This is particularly important in modern BMWs, where many systems are logically interconnected.

Product Characteristics and Selection by Numbers
The module belongs to the original BMW line, which means it has been designed for specific model platforms and their equipment configurations. In practice, this translates to matching connectors, compatible communication protocols, and appropriate hardware and software parameters.
The selection of the correct unit should be based on the OEM part number and available interchangeable numbers, taking into account the body version and model year of the vehicle. If in doubt, it is advisable to use the VIN number and service documentation to confirm compatibility before installation.
